Hands-On With Zoom, Fisheye, Wide And Macro Lenses For iPhone and iPad [Reviews]

One disadvantage of using an iPhone or iPad as a camera is that you’re stuck with a single, fixed focal-length lens. Optical zoom can work only so far before even Instagram photos start to look bad, and phones with built in optical zooms tend to resemble actual cameras. The solution? Add-on lenses.
